Our project aims to help the Umass Wrestling and Brazilian Jiu-Jitsu Clubs improve upon their process of raising and lowering wrestling mats using the existing hoisting system found in the Recreation Center. We designed a wooden prototype of an analogous hoisting system, coupled with a DC motor to lower and raise a 3d printed cylinder, representing a wrestling mat. We then implemented a React Interface and Arduino Programming allowing for control over the motor via virtual up and down buttons. We used the Makerboard and L298n Motor Controller to achieve this. Lastly, we completed the basic circuitry required to control a drill motor via our application.
